成人AV在线无码|婷婷五月激情色,|伊人加勒比二三四区|国产一区激情都市|亚洲AV无码电影|日av韩av无码|天堂在线亚洲Av|无码一区二区影院|成人无码毛片AV|超碰在线看中文字幕

html5居中對齊怎么弄

一、介紹在Web頁面中,居中對齊是一種常見的布局需求。HTML5提供了多種方法來實(shí)現(xiàn)居中對齊,包括水平居中和垂直居中。本文將詳細(xì)介紹這些方法,并通過示例演示如何使用它們。二、水平居中1. 使用marg

一、介紹

在Web頁面中,居中對齊是一種常見的布局需求。HTML5提供了多種方法來實(shí)現(xiàn)居中對齊,包括水平居中和垂直居中。本文將詳細(xì)介紹這些方法,并通過示例演示如何使用它們。

二、水平居中

1. 使用margin實(shí)現(xiàn)水平居中:

當(dāng)元素的寬度已知時,可以使用auto值來將左右的margin設(shè)置為相等,從而實(shí)現(xiàn)元素的水平居中對齊。例如:

```css

.center {

margin-left: auto;

margin-right: auto;

width: 200px; /* 元素的寬度 */

}

```

2. 使用text-align實(shí)現(xiàn)水平居中:

對于內(nèi)聯(lián)元素和文本,可以使用text-align屬性將其內(nèi)容進(jìn)行水平居中對齊。例如:

```css

.center {

text-align: center;

}

```

三、垂直居中

1. 使用display和margin實(shí)現(xiàn)垂直居中:

當(dāng)元素的高度已知時,可以使用display屬性將元素的表現(xiàn)方式設(shè)置為table,并通過margin屬性實(shí)現(xiàn)垂直居中對齊。例如:

```css

.center {

display: table;

margin-top: auto;

margin-bottom: auto;

height: 200px; /* 元素的高度 */

}

```

2. 使用flexbox實(shí)現(xiàn)垂直居中:

使用flexbox布局可以更方便地實(shí)現(xiàn)元素的垂直居中對齊。首先將容器的display屬性設(shè)置為flex,然后使用align-items屬性將子元素垂直居中。例如:

```css

.container {

display: flex;

align-items: center;

}

.center {

margin: 0 auto;

}

```

四、示例演示

下面是一個示例演示,展示了如何通過HTML5來實(shí)現(xiàn)元素的水平居中和垂直居中對齊:

```html

居中對齊

```

在上述示例中,通過設(shè)定body元素的高度、display屬性和align-items屬性,將.container容器中的.center元素實(shí)現(xiàn)了水平和垂直居中對齊。

總結(jié):

本文通過詳細(xì)介紹和示例演示了如何使用HTML5來實(shí)現(xiàn)元素的水平居中和垂直居中對齊。希望讀者可以通過本文的指導(dǎo)和實(shí)例代碼,更加靈活地應(yīng)用HTML5技術(shù)來布局頁面,并滿足各種對齊需求。